A casting that moves from Inner Truth into Peace means the situation you asked about is not static — it begins as one pattern and resolves into another. The first hexagram describes where you stand; the second describes where events are carrying you.
Highlighted in red: lines 3, 5 and 6 are moving — counted from the bottom. A moving line is where the change is actually happening: it flips from yang to yin or back, and that flip is what turns Inner Truth into Peace.
The situation: Hexagram 61, Inner Truth
Sincerity at the center moves even the stubborn.
Wind stirring the lake from a hollow center — an open heart that moves everything it touches. This is the sincerity hexagram, the one about truth so steady it reaches creatures that can't even understand your words. The power here is specific: inner conviction, honestly held and quietly consistent, changes minds that arguments bounce off of. Not performance — people can smell performed sincerity three rooms away. The real thing requires you to know what you actually believe first. Get clear on that, then act from it uniformly, especially when nobody's watching. Trust built this way carries weight across every gap: teams, families, negotiations, the whole stubborn world.
Structurally, Inner Truth is Lake below Wind — the inner state meeting the outer condition. That pairing is the lens for everything above.
